Job Summary

  • The Hearing Instrument Specialist is responsible for the identification and rehabilitation of hearing impairment including determining the appropriateness and benefit of amplification, as well as providing basic audiometric testing.
  • The HIS dispenses hearing aids independently to patients aged 18 years and older, and performs diagnostic hearing and/or balance testing, under the supervision of a licensed audiologist, depending on specialties assigned.
